Illinois State Looked For National Access In Signing First Multimedia Deal With Learfield

While Illinois State's 10-year, $19.8M deal with Learfield, will "not mean an immediate multi-million dollar infusion of cash," AD Larry Lyons is "convinced the university's first multimedia rights deal will provide a bevy of benefits to ISU athletics," according to Randy Reinhardt of the Bloomington PANTAGRAPH. The Learfield deal makes ISU the "eighth among 10 Missouri Valley Conference institutions to enter such a pact." Lyons said of waiting until this past fall to put out an RFP, "We were a little slower to get to this point for good reason. We were doing it ourselves internally at what we thought was a pretty good level." Lyons said of choosing Learfield, "What they bring to the table is the national folks that invest in college athletics. We didn't have access to those people. We couldn't get in their front door as Illinois State by ourselves." Reinhardt noted ISU as part of the deal "receives approximately $375,000 of in-kind gifts per year" (Bloomington PANTAGRAPH, 5/1).
